/* Univers Générique */

#bandeauGauche {
	float: left;
	width: 192px;
	margin:0 2px 0 0;
}

#menuGauche {
	background-color: white;
	margin: 0pt 0pt 2px;
}

#menuGauche table#nav {
	width: 192px;
}

#menuGauche table#nav th,
#menuGauche table#nav td {
	background-color: #daddf0;
	border-bottom: 2px solid white;
	height: 38px !important;
	padding: 0pt 20px;
	vertical-align: middle;
}

#menuGauche table#nav th {
	background-color: #eeeeee;
	font-size: 13px;
	font-weight: bold;
	letter-spacing: -1px;
	padding: 0pt 0pt 0pt 10px;
	text-align: left;
}

#menuGauche table#nav td {
	font-size: 11px;
	font-weight: normal;
	letter-spacing: 0px;
	cursor: pointer;
}

#menuGauche table#nav th.actif{
	background-color: #426bb3;
	color: white;
	cursor: pointer;
}

#menuGauche table#nav th.actif a{
	color: white;
}

#menuGauche table#nav td.actif {
	font-size: 11px;
	font-weight: normal;
	letter-spacing: 0px;
	background-color: #426bb3;
	color: white;
	cursor: pointer;
}

#bandeauGauche div.boxLiens {
	background-color: #eeeeee;
	border-bottom: 4px solid white;
	margin: 0pt;
	padding: 0pt;
}

#bandeauGauche div.boxLiens p.titre {
	color: #113388;
	font-size: 13px;
	font-weight: bold;
	margin: 0pt;
	padding: 2px 10px 2px 9px;
}

#bandeauGauche div.boxLiens p.resume {
	margin: 0pt;
	padding: 3px 10px 6px 9px;
}

#bandeauGauche div.boxLiens div.picto {
	float: left;
	margin: 0pt;
}

#bandeauGauche div.boxLiens div.picto img {
	margin: 0pt 0pt 8px 8px;
}

#bandeauGauche div.boxLiens div.liens {
	float: left;
	margin: 3px 0pt 4px;
	position: relative;
	width: 152px;
}

#bandeauGauche div.boxLiens div.liens p {
	background: transparent url(../../images/v25/puce_droite_bleue.gif) no-repeat scroll 5px;
	margin: 0pt 0pt 2px;
	padding: 0pt 10px 0pt 14px;
}

#bandeauGauche div.boxLiens div.liens p a {
	color: #113388;
	text-decoration: none;
}

#bandeauGauche div.boxLiens div.liens p a:hover {
	text-decoration: underline;
}

#centre {
	float: left;
	width: 792px
}

#main {
	margin: 5px 0pt 0pt 5px;
	width: 787px
}

#chemin {
	margin: 0pt 0pt 8px;
	color: #7D7D7D;
	font-family: arial;
	font-size: 10px;
	padding: 0pt;
	text-align: left;
}

#chemin a {
	color: #113388;
	text-decoration: none;
}

#chemin a:hover {
	text-decoration: underline;
}
#centralniv2 {
	width:787px;
}
#centralniv2 table {
	border: 0px none;
	margin: 0px;
	padding: 0px;
	color: #4D606D;
	font-family: Verdana,Arial,Helvetica,sans-serif;
	font-size: 11px;
	text-align:left;
}

#centralniv2 a {
	font-family: Verdana,Arial,Helvetica,sans-serif;
	font-size: 11px;
}

#centralniv2 a.test,
#centralniv2 a.test:hover,
#centralniv2 a.test1,
#centralniv2 a.test2:hover,
#centralniv2 a.detail:hover {
	text-decoration: none;
}

#centralniv2 a.test2 {
	text-decoration: underline;
}

#centralniv2 a.test:hover,
#centralniv2 a.test1:hover,
#centralniv2 a.test2:hover,
#centralniv2 a.detail:hover {
	color: #4D606D;
}

#centralniv2 img {
	border: 0pt none white;
	vertical-align: top;
}
.formulaire .lbbloc {
	background-color:#EDEEF0;
	font-size:10pt;
	font-style:normal;
	font-variant:normal;
	font-weight:bold;
	height:13px;
	padding:3px 10px 10px;
	border-style:solid;
	border-width:0 0 0;
	vertical-align:middle;
	line-height:13px;
	color:#113388;
	width:750px;
}
.formulaire .lbdonf {
	font-style:normal;
	vertical-align:middle;
	font-size:11px;
	font-weight:bold;
}
.leftButtonBlue {
	background-color:#113388;
	float:left;
	border:medium none;
	height:21px;
	margin:0;
	padding:0;
	width:10px;
	text-decoration:none;
}
.blueButton {
	background-color:#113388;
	border:medium none;
	color:#FFFFFF;
	float:left;
	font-family:Verdana,Arial,Geneva,Helvetica,sans-serif;
	font-size:11px;
	font-weight:bolder;
	margin:0;
	padding:0;
	text-align:left;
	line-height:16px;
	height:20px !important;
	height:21px;
	padding-top: 1px;
	text-decoration:none;
	
}
.rightButtonBlue {
	background-color:#113388;
	float:left;
	border:medium none;
	height:21px;
	margin:0;
	padding:0;
	width:10px;
	text-decoration:none;
}